One could argue that a properly designed programming language would forbid downcasts completely, or provide safe casts alternatives, e.g. ![]() When type systems are concerned, upcasts put the burden of the proof on the compiler (which has to check it statically), downcasts put the burden of the proof on the programmer (which has to think hard about it). Essentially, the programmer is telling the compiler "trust me, I know better - this will be OK at runtime". Since the second is a dangerous operation, most typed programming languages require the programmer to explicitly ask for it. Downcasts can result in a runtime error, when the object runtime type is not a subtype of the type used in the cast. ![]()

The cameras can be manually updated via the trigger_camera service which will ignore the throttling caused by scan_interval. Since the cameras are battery operated, setting the scan_interval must be done with care so as to not drain the battery too quickly, or hammer Blink’s servers with too many API requests. A binary_sensor motion detection, camera armed status, and battery status.A sensor per camera for temperature and Wi-Fi strength.A camera for each camera linked to your Blink sync module. ![]() An alarm_control_panel to arm/disarm the whole blink system (note, alarm_arm_home is not implemented and will not actually do anything, despite it being an option in the GUI).Once Home Assistant starts and you authenticate access, the blink integration will create the following platforms (note: Blink Mini cameras do not currently support any of the sensors, nor the battery status binary sensor): After a few minutes (at most) this information should populate.
